Dark clouds still loom over Ecclestone's F1 reign

Dark clouds still loom over Ecclestone's F1 reign 21 February, 2014 Bernie Ecclestone German media company  Constantin Medien will appeal the verdict in Formula 1 supremo Bernie Ecclestone's London court civil case amid the Formula 1 bribery scandal. On Thursday, the high court judge dismissed Constantin Medien's $140 million claim against the Formula 1 chief executive, but did find that the 83-year-old had been 'corrupt' and paid a 'bribe' to jailed banker Gerhard Gribkowsky. 'The judge ruled against Constantin essentially on technical grounds, including extremely complicated questions of German law which is the governing law in the case,' Constantin's lawyers said in a statement....
